Move musb_hdrc driver init into the init section, by switching over to use
platform_driver_probe().  Shrinks this driver's run-time footprint by about
5KB ... pretty good for linker level tweaks to just one (big) driver, and
there's a bit more shrinkage yet to be had (for DMA init).
